Хелпикс

Главная

Контакты

Случайная статья





Задание оформить в текстовом редакторе MS Word и отправить на электронную почту: informatica_2013@mail.ru



Задание оформить в текстовом редакторе MS Word и отправить на электронную почту: informatica_2013@mail.ru

ТЕМА:

ПОСТРОЕНИЕ ТАБЛИЦ ИСТИННОСТИ ДЛЯ ЛОГИЧЕСКИХ ВЫРАЖЕНИЙ

Цель работы: формировать умения строить и заполнять таблицы истинности.

Порядок выполнения работы

1. Повторить материал по теме «Построение таблиц истинности для логических выражений».

2. Закрепить полученные навыки при решении задач.

 

Таблицу, показывающую, какие значения принимает со­ставное высказывание при всех сочетаниях (наборах) значений входящих в него простых высказываний, называют таблицей истинности составного высказывания.

Составные высказывания в алгебре логики записываются с помощью логических выражений. Для любого логического вы­ражения достаточно просто построить таблицу истинности.

Алгоритм построения таблицы истинности:

1. подсчитать количество переменных п в логическом выра­жении;

2. определить число строк в таблице, которое равно т = 2n;

3. подсчитать количество логических операций в логиче­ском выражении и определить количество столбцов в таблице, которое равно количеству переменных плюс количество опера­ций;

4.ввести названия столбцов таблицы в соответствии с после­довательностью выполнения логических операций с учетом скобок и приоритетов;

5.заполнить столбцы входных переменных наборами значе­ний;

6.провести заполнение таблицы истинности по столбцам, выполняя логические операции в соответствии с установленной в п.4 последовательностью.

Задание 1.

Для формулы A&(B & ) построить таблицу истинности алгебраически и с

использованием электронных таблиц.

1) Количество логических переменных 3, следовательно, коли­чество строк в таблице истинности должно быть 23 = 8.

2)

Таблица 1.
Количество логических операций в формуле 5, следователь­но количество столбцов в таблице истинности должно быть 3 + 5 = 8.

A B C & B ( & ) A&( B & )

Задание 2.!!!

Символом F обозначено одно из указанных ниже логических выражений от трех аргументов: X, Y, Z.

Дан фрагмент таблицы истинности выражения F:Какое выражение соответствует F?

1) X Ù Y Ù Z; 2) X Ù Y Ù Z;    3) X Ú Y Ú Z;    4) X Ú Y Ú Z.

Решение:

1) нужно для каждой строчки подставить заданные значения X, Y и Z во все функции, заданные в ответах, и сравнить результаты с соответствующими значениями F для этих данных

2) если для какой-нибудь комбинации X, Y и Z результат не совпадает с соответствующим значением F, оставшиеся строчки можно не рассматривать, поскольку для правильного ответа все три результата должны совпасть со значениями функции F

3) перепишем ответы в других обозначениях:
             1)         2)       3) 4)

4) первое выражение, , равно 1 только при

5) второе выражение, , равно 1 только при  

6) третье выражение, , равно нулю только при

7)

Таблица 2.
наконец, четвертое выражение,  равно нулю только тогда, когда , а в остальных случаях равно 1, что совпадает с приведенной частью таблицы истинности

X Y Z F
0 × 0 ×
0 ×

Задания для самостоятельного выполнения:

Задание 3.(повторение)

Составьте таблицы истинности для логического выражения:

F= A B &`D.

 
Задание 4.(оформление см.зад.2)

X Y Z F

Символом F обозначено одно из указанных ниже логических выражений от трех аргументов: X, Y, Z. Дан фрагмент таблицы истинности выражения F (см. таблицу справа). Какое выражение соответствует F?

 

a) X Ú Y Ú Z;            b) X Ù Y Ù Z ; c) X Ù Y Ù Z;  d) X Ú Y Ú Z .

Задание 5.

X Y Z F

Символом F обозначено одно из указанных ниже логических выражений от трех аргументов: X, Y, Z. Дан фрагмент таблицы истинности выражения F

 (см. таблицу справа). Какое выражение соответствует F?

a) X Ú Y Ú Z;          b) X Ù Y Ù Z ; c) X Ù Y Ù Z; d) X Ú Y Ú Z .



  

© helpiks.su При использовании или копировании материалов прямая ссылка на сайт обязательна.